Understanding What Rusty or Brown Water Indicates

When tap water appears brown, orange, or reddish, it often signals the presence of iron particles or sediment. These particles may originate from inside the home plumbing system or from the broader water supply before it enters the property.


In many cases, the discoloration is not constant. Water may run clear for long periods and then suddenly appear rusty after pipes have been unused, such as first thing in the morning or after returning from travel. Common Rusty Water Causes in a Home Plumbing System

Pipe Corrosion and Aging Plumbing Materials

One of the most common rusty water cause factors is internal pipe corrosion. Older homes often have galvanized steel or cast-iron pipes, which are more prone to rust as they age. Over time, the protective coating inside these pipes breaks down, allowing iron to oxidize and flake into the water.


As water flows through corroded sections, it can pick up rust particles, leading to discoloration at the tap. This process tends to accelerate in areas with fluctuating water pressure or mineral-heavy water.

Sediment Disturbance in Water Lines

Sediment naturally accumulates inside water lines, even in systems that are otherwise functioning correctly. This sediment may include sand, minerals, or iron particles that settle when water flow is minimal.


When water flow suddenly increases—during hydrant flushing, nearby construction, or after a plumbing repair—sediment can be disturbed, causing temporary rusty or brown water that clears after several minutes.


Repeated disturbances may suggest sediment buildup is widespread within the home plumbing system, indicating the need for a more thorough evaluation.


Water Heater Rust and Internal Tank Issues

Water heater rust is another frequent contributor to discolored water, particularly when the issue appears only in hot water. Traditional tank-style water heaters contain a sacrificial anode rod designed to corrode instead of the tank itself. Over time, this rod degrades.


Once the anode rod is depleted, the tank interior may rust, causing brown or orange discoloration at hot water taps. This issue may also coincide with changes in water temperature consistency or unusual noises from the heater.


Checking whether discoloration occurs in both hot and cold water can help narrow down whether the water heater rust is a contributing factor.


Municipal Water Supply Changes

Not all rusty water causes originate within the home. Municipal water systems periodically perform maintenance, adjust treatment processes, or respond to main breaks. These activities can temporarily introduce sediment or dislodge iron particles in supply lines.


In such cases, multiple homes in the same area may notice similar discoloration. Understanding whether neighbors experience similar conditions can help differentiate between supply-side and home-specific causes.

When Rusty or Brown Water Is More Noticeable

Discolored water often appears under specific conditions rather than continuously. Common situations include:

  • After water has been sitting unused in pipes for several hours
  • During seasonal changes that affect water demand
  • Following nearby infrastructure work or repairs
  • When hot water is used after long periods of inactivity


These patterns can indicate whether the issue is localized, temporary, or related to a specific component of the home plumbing system.

Potential Impacts on Plumbing Performance and Household Use

While rusty or brown water does not automatically indicate a health concern, it can affect daily household activities. Discolored water may stain sinks, tubs, laundry, and fixtures. Over time, sediment and corrosion can also contribute to reduced water pressure and uneven flow.


Ongoing corrosion can weaken pipes and fittings, and sediment buildup may strain valves, faucets, and appliances that rely on clean water flow. Understanding these limitations helps homeowners weigh practical implications rather than focusing solely on appearance.

Frequently Asked Questions

  • Is rusty or brown water always coming from inside the home?

    Not always. While internal pipe corrosion and water heater rust are common, municipal supply changes can also temporarily affect water color.

  • Does rusty water mean the water is unsafe to use?

    Discoloration alone does not determine safety. However, it may affect taste, staining, and appliance performance, which is why understanding the cause matters.

  • Why does the water look rusty only when using hot water?

    This often points to water heater rust or sediment inside the heater tank, especially in older units.

  • Can sediment cause water discoloration even in newer homes?

    Yes. Sediment can enter newer systems from the water supply or during maintenance activities, even if pipes are relatively new.

  • How long should I flush the water if it appears brown?

    Flushing for several minutes may clear temporary sediment, but recurring discoloration suggests a need for further evaluation.

  • Is pipe corrosion more common in older homes?

    Older plumbing materials, such as galvanized steel, are more prone to corrosion, making age a relevant factor.

  • When should discoloration be checked by a professional?

    If rusty or brown water persists, worsens, or affects multiple fixtures consistently, a professional review can help clarify the underlying factors.
